Gerontology is the scientific study of aging and the biological, psychological, and social processes that shape later life. It appears across a range of disciplines, including nursing, public health, social work, and allied health sciences, making it a common subject in both undergraduate and graduate coursework. The field is academically compelling because aging affects virtually every dimension of human experience — from cellular biology to policy design — and global demographic shifts have made the health and well-being of older adults an increasingly urgent area of inquiry. Students are often asked to examine how physical decline, cognitive change, and social circumstance interact to shape the lives of elderly patients and older adult populations.

A strong essay in gerontology begins with a clearly scoped thesis that targets one aspect of aging — clinical, social, or psychological — rather than attempting to survey the entire field. Evidence drawn from patient assessment frameworks, health outcome data, and established care protocols tends to carry the most weight in science-oriented courses. A common pitfall is conflating gerontology with geriatrics; the former is a broad interdisciplinary study of aging, while the latter is a medical specialty, and keeping that distinction clear strengthens analytical precision.
